Following PS4HEN v2.1.3, the PS4HEN v2.1.4 Fork, ESP8266 Xploit Host 2.84g, the PS4 6.72 Jailbreak Exploit Menu v6 updates and PS4 Cheater 1.4.8 with 6.72 support by GiantPluto, today PlayStation scene developers @Joonie (Joonie86) and SiSTR0 made available a PS4HEN 2.1.3 with 7.51 FW Version Spoof 6.72 Port for PS4JB 6.72 users that includes the following features listed below: šŸ˜

And from the README.md: PS4HEN v2.1.3

Features

  • Homebrew Enabler
  • Jailbreak
  • Sandbox Escape
  • Debug Settings
  • External HDD Support
  • VR Support
  • Remote Package Install
  • Rest Mode Support
  • External HDD Format 7.xx Support
  • FW Version Spoof to 7.02 (5.05) / 7.51 (6.72)
  • Debug Trophies Support
  • sys_dynlib_dlsym Patch
  • UART Enabler
  • Never Disable Screenshot
  • Remote Play Enabler
